Types of Cannabis Seeds

When exploring the diverse world of cannabis seeds, its essential to recognize the distinct types that cater to various cultivation needs and preferences. Primarily, cannabis seeds can be categorized into three main types: regular, feminized, and auto-flowering.

Regular seeds offer the chance of producing both male and female plants, making them ideal for breeders aiming to create new strains or maintain genetic diversity. On the other hand, feminized seeds are engineered to ensure that nearly every plant grown will be female, which is highly desirable for those seeking potent buds without the concern of males ruining their crop.

Lastly, auto-flowering seeds are a game-changer, boasting the unique ability to flower automatically after a certain period, regardless of light cycles. This rapid growth can yield multiple harvests in a single season, appealing to both novice and experienced growers alike.

Each type presents its own advantages and challenges, influencing everything from growth times to yield, and ultimately shaping the landscape of cannabis cultivation.

How to Choose Quality Cannabis Seeds

Choosing quality cannabis seeds is a crucial step that can significantly influence your cultivation journey. First, consider the source; reputable seed banks or breeders are essential for obtaining seeds that are not only viable but also genetically stable.

Look for strains with a well-documented lineage and strong reviews from other growers, as this can provide insight into their growth characteristics. Genetics matter—a hybrid may offer the best of both indica and sativa, while pure strains can deliver specific effects or medical benefits.

Furthermore, examine the seeds themselves; healthy seeds should be dark brown and have a nice sheen, while pale or green seeds may lack vigor. Lastly, don’t ignore the flowering time and yield potential; these factors can vary widely and should align with your growing goals and timeline.

Armed with this information, you’re better equipped to select seeds that will flourish and fulfill your cannabis cultivation aspirations.
